Council rates are a property tax. council rates calculator adelaide hills Rating options include having a general or single rate apply to all properties, having a different rate according to property uses/location, having a separate rate for a particular purpose in part of a council area, having a service rate or charge for a specific service like septic tank effluent disposal and having a fixed (flat) charge as part of the general/single rate. Councils may use site value (land only), capital value (land plus improvements) or annual value (rental), however, the majority use capital value. If your land value increases, it doesn't necessarily mean your rates will rise as they depend on: your council's rating structure Councils can provide rate relief to certain ratepayers in specific circumstances such as financial hardship (enquiries of this type need to be made to your council, and are confidential). Council rates represent less than 4% of the total taxes paid by Australians, and SA households pay on average around $29 per week in council rates. While the levy is a State tax, Council is required, under the Landscape South Australia Act 2019 (the Act), to make a specified annual contribution to the Landscape Administration Fund, which is distributed to the Hills & Fleurieu Regional Landscape Board (the Board) and to recover this amount by way of the levy. Councils can use valuations provided by the Valuer-General or a valuer authorised under the Land Valuers Act 1994 engaged by the council.
